作品年表
2019
电影
星際救援
饰演:Brigadier General Stroud
2017
电影
天賦的禮物
饰演:Aubrey Highsmith
2002
电影
捉智雙雄
饰演:Assistant Director Marsh
1993
电影
The Pelican Brief
饰演:Matthew Barr
1993
电影
Cliffhanger
饰演:Agent Michaels
1993
剧集
X 檔案
饰演:Michael Kritschgau